Asia-Pacific Economic Cooperation (APEC)
Context: APEC members failed to agree on a communique at a summit in Papua New Guinea What is APEC? The forum initially started as an informal dialogue of economic leaders in 1989 in Canberra, Australia. It was formally established in 1993 with 12 members. Currently, APEC has 21 member economies.
